Summary
On 28 August 2025 at about 02:15 local time, a Cessna 172R registered N5181A, operated by Southeastern Oklahoma State University, was involved in an accident near Ardmore, Oklahoma, United States. One person was on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ause
The pilot’s improper landing flare, which resulted in a hard, bounced landing.

The purpose of the flight was for the pilot to conduct solo night training to include takeoff and landing practice. The flight school reported that during the landing, the airplane bounced 3 to 4 times on the runway before coming to a stop. As a result of the hard landing, the airplane sustained substantial damage to the lower fuselage. The flight school chief pilot stated that a greater emphasis should have been placed on training for night illusions and that there were no mechanical malfunctions or failures that would have precluded normal operation.
